If I took a 2017 GLS550, what should the discount be over a 2018?
Hi all. I already have an offer of 7% off on a 2018 GLS550 from a local dealer. They have a brand new, similarly equipped 2017 GLS550 leftover. Obviously, depreciation will have reduced the value even though it is still a new truck, but how much additional should I expect because of it? Would 15% off list be equitable? Do you think they would go that far, and how much depreciation of a new truck has occurred because of the model year change? I would appreciate any help you all can offer and than you all in advance.

Well...
If you have a 7% off deal on a 2018 GLS550 that has the equip that you want - go for it - since 2-3-4yrs from know you have a one added/newer year of value over a 2017 which will more-than-make-up in future dollars any reasonable additional discount you might get today on a new 2017 which will not be out to 15% off.
In my mind - to get 15% off on a GLS550 - you would need to locate a "dealer demo/service-loaner" or a "brass-hat" Mercedes executive vehicle - and both would qualify for Mercedes new car finance rates and/or Mercedes lease rates - and especially lease the added discount really helps payment wise.
